基于模糊自整定PID的注水流量控制系统

摘    要:针对注水流量控制系统的控制对象数学模型难建立,同时由于井下环境复杂,控制系统存在严重的非线性的问题,采用模糊自整定PID控制算法,设计了基于TMS320F2812模糊自整定PID控制器。该验结果表明模糊自整定PID控制能够满足系统的控制精度要求,具有动态和稳态性能好等优点。

Design of Water Injection Flow Control System Based on Fuzzy Self-tuning PID

Abstract:It is hard to establish the mathematical model for the system of water injection flow control,and because the conditions in the mine are complex,there are serious nonlinear in the control system.This paper used fuzzy self-tuning PID control algorithm to design a controller based on the TMS320F2812.The results show that the fuzzy self-tuning PID control algorithm can meet the control precision of the system requirements with good dynamic and steady state performance.
